ABCB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2017 in Review

180 of the 4,409 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Ameris Bancorp (ABCB) for Q4 2017, worth a combined $1.54B — up 4.1% from $1.48B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 20 funds opened new ABCB positions and 14 closed out — a net gain of 6 holders — while 71 added to existing stakes and 55 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Stephens Investment Management Group, opening a new position worth an estimated $13.6M. The largest seller was Wellington Management Group, cutting an estimated $9.3M.
